Commerce: Inquiry and Skills has been written to explicitly align with the new Commerce Years 7'10 syllabus in NSW and address the most recent changes in the economy, the law and the political arena. All core and options topics are covered in detail, with an overarching focus on supporting student inquiry and skills-development. The text develops the knowledge and skills students need to research and develop solutions to consumer, financial, economic, business, legal, political and employment issues, and make informed decisions. A diverse range of contemporary case studies and Spotlight boxes have been included to ground student knowledge in real-life contexts and spark engagement. The Economics, Civics and Citizenship student book, CD ROM and homework book have been developed by a team of experienced classroom teachers to meet the specific requirements of the newly developed Victorian Essential Learning Standards ( VELS ) Stages 5 - 6. This full-coloured text, CD ROM and supporting student homework book allows the student to develop pathways through the three strands Physical, Personal and Social Learning, Discipline-based Learning and Interdisciplinary Learning, using a verity of resources from conventional text to ICT-based activities. These resources engage the student to achieve a level of economic and civic knowledge and understanding required to communicate and operate effectively in today's community. Values and attitudes are also explored to assist the student to make considered decisions about present and future financial, civic and citizenship matters. Students using this text will gain a solid foundation for the study of VCE Economics, Business Management and Legal Studies.     Hybrid. Condition: new. Hybrid. Commerce.dot.com has been fully revised and updated, while retaining its original features that proved so popular. It incorporates the four core topics of the NSW Commerce syllabus: consumer choice, personal finance, law and society, and employment issues, while providing plenty of examples to consolidate student understanding. Knowledge, understanding and skills are developed using a variety of resources, from conventional to ICT-based activities. The text and associated activities encourage students to achieve a level of financial literacy necessary to operate effectively in a commercial environment. Values and attitudes are also explored to assist students in making considered decisions about present and future financial matters. The printed book is also available as a digital NelsonNetbook.
